About This Item

New York: Doubleday, Page & Co.. Fair. 1907. First Edition. Hardcover. 12mo 7" - 7½" tall; 236 pages; 1907 Doubleday, Page & Co. HC 1st edition. Bound in original slate black cloth with title designs in mixed cream and black to cover and spine. Rubbed and worn with moderate fraying to cloth at spine ends; gilt and white title design rubbed and faded at spine and dulled to cover. Cloth rubbed through at corner tips; a small shallow worm hole front edge. Binding sound but shaken with tender hinges. Fair to Good only reading copy of this novel of Wall Street disaster. .

About DogStar Books

DogStar Books is an open-shop used and rare book store located in historic Lancaster PA. We have been buying and selling scholarly, antiquarian and better books, images, and paper since 1991. We maintain a large general collection of over 40,000 titles on premises to serve our local book loving clientele. Out of town visitors and buyers are always welcome.
